  • This paper focuses on small nuclear power plant which adopts OTSG. Based on static mathematical models of some important parts such as reactor core, steam generator etc., combined with the control strategy of MRX, the paper simulates the dynamic feature during load following process of small NPP. Moreover, the paper analysis the operation coordination via heat transfer time and control time delaying. According to the Matlab/Simulink simulation results, the control strategy of MRX is valid and suitable for the power following of NPP. The operating time of the second-circuit system is relatively longer, and the response rate feed water flow is lower than that of the nuclear power changing. In practical application, it should be considered to adopt the fast response electric pump.
